Driveway Sealing in Denver, CO
Driveway s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of asphalt driveways to help extend their lifespan and improve their appearance. This process is suitable for various projects, including residential driveways, parking areas, and other paved surfaces. Property owners typically seek driveway sealing to prevent damage from water, UV rays, and everyday wear and tear, which can lead to cracks, potholes, and a dull appearance over time. Understanding the condition of the existing surface and the type of sealant used are important considerations before requesting this service, ensuring the right product and application method are chosen.
Homeowners often want to know about the benefits of sealing, such as enhanced curb appeal and added protection against the elements, as well as the necessary preparation steps for proper application. It’s also helpful to inquire about the recommended frequency of sealing to maintain the surface’s integrity. Properly sealed driveways can resist weather-related damage more effectively, helping to preserve the investment in the property’s exterior. Driveway Sealing Questions
What is driveway sealing? Driveway s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to prevent damage from water, UV rays, and traffic.
How often should a driveway be sealed? Sealing is typically rec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ain the surface’s durability and appearance.
What are common signs that a driveway needs sealing? Cracks, fading, and surface wear are signs that sealing may help protect the asphalt from further damage.
Does sealing extend the lifespan of a driveway? Yes, sealing helps shield the surface from elements and traffic, potentially extending its usable life.
